Web21 feb. 2024 · In 2024, 65% of adults were overweight or obese ( BMI of 25 kg/m² or greater). Following an increase between 2003 and 2008 (62% to 65%), the prevalence of overweight including obesity has remained stable since, fluctuating between 64% and 65%.

Web7 jul. 2024 · In 2024–18, 1 in 4 (25%) children and adolescents aged 2–17 were overweight or obese (an estimated 1.2 million children and adolescents). Of all children and adolescents aged 2–17, 17% were overweight but not obese, and 8.2% were obese. Rates varied across age groups, but were similar for males and females (ABS 2024a).
